Hypertension, a global health concern, requires continuous advancements in management strategies to improve patient outcomes. This article explores modern approaches to hypertension management, offering insights to healthcare professionals.
Personalized medicine is increasingly recognized as a valuable approach to hypertension management. This strategy involves tailoring treatment to the individual patient's genetic profile, lifestyle, and comorbidities. It allows for more precise treatment, potentially improving efficacy and reducing side effects.
Combination therapy, involving two or more antihypertensive agents, is another modern approach. This strategy can enhance therapeutic efficacy, particularly in patients with resistant hypertension. The choice of combination is guided by the patient's clinical profile and potential drug-drug interactions.
Device-based therapies represent a novel approach for patients unresponsive to pharmacological interventions. Renal denervation and baroreflex activation therapy are examples of such interventions that have shown promising results in clinical trials.
Telemedicine, the use of digital technology for remote patient monitoring and consultation, is becoming an integral part of hypertension management. It enables regular blood pressure monitoring, timely medication adjustments, and improved patient adherence to treatment.
Despite advancements in pharmacological and device-based therapies, lifestyle modifications remain a cornerstone of hypertension management. A balanced diet, regular physical activity, and stress management techniques can significantly contribute to blood pressure control.
Modern approaches to hypertension management encompass personalized medicine, combination therapy, device-based therapies, telemedicine, and lifestyle modifications. While these strategies offer promising advancements, their successful implementation requires a comprehensive understanding and adaptability from healthcare professionals. Ongoing research and collaboration are critical to refine these strategies and optimize hypertension management.
